HD32.2 – WBGT Index is an instrument made by Delta OHM srl for the analysis of
WBGT index (Wet Bulb Glob Temperature: wet bulb temperature and globe thermom-
eter temperature) in presence or in absence of solar radiation.
Reference Regulations:
ISO 7243: Hot environments. Estimation of the heat stress on working man, based on
WBGT index (wet bulb temperature and Globe thermometer).
ISO 8996: Ergonomics of the thermal environment – Determination of the energy
metabolism.
ISO 7726: Ergonomics of the thermal environment – Instruments for measuring
physical quantities.

WBGT index
WBGT (Wet Bulb Globe Temperature – Wet bulb temperature and globe thermometer)
is one of the indexes used to determinate the occupational heat exposure.
It represents the value, related to the metabolic expenditure linked to a specifi c work
activity, that causes a thermal stress when exceeded.
WBGT index combines the temperature measurement of wet bulb with natural ven-
tilation t
nw
with the globe thermometer t
g
and, in some situations, with the air tem-
perature t
a
.
The calculation formula is the following:
inside and outside a buildings in absence of solar radiation:
WBGT
close environments
= 0,7 t
nw
+ 0,3 t
g
outside a building in presence of solar radiation:
WBGT
outside environments
= 0,7 t
nw
+ 0,2 t
g
+ 0,1 t
a
where:
t
nw
= natural wet bulb;
t
g
= globe thermometer temperature;
t
a
= air temperature.
The measured data should be compared with the limit values prescribed by the regu-
lations;
when exceeded you have to:
reduce directly the thermal stress on the examined work place;
proceed to a detailed analysis of the thermal stress.
In order to measure the WBGT index, the following probes should be connected:
Natural wet bulb HP3201.2 (HP3201).
TP3276.2 Globe thermometer probe (TP3276 or TP3275).
TP3207.2 (TP3207) Dry bulb temperature, if the measurement is performed in
presence of solar radiation.
In order to measure the WBGT index, you should refer to the following regula-
tions:
ISO 7726
ISO 7243
ISO 8996
